PAPAROA NEWS.

Mr. Ilnmblyn, instructor in agriculture ] for North Auckland, addressed a meeting of ratepayers in explanation ana furtherance of the small farm scheme. Mr. .T. Scott Davidson, riding councillor, presided. Many questions were asked and clearly answered by Mr. Ilamblyn, who also said the department would welcome suggestions as to working the scheme from the farmers. A riding committee, consisting of Messrs. T. Wilson, R. Dodds, and J. W. Cliff, was appointed to co-operate with the Department. Settlers generally who mav be prejudiced against the scheme are advised to I await the visit of the organiser before I-passing judgment on.:it, _
